For 26 years, until Ahmadinejad came to power in 2005 there were virtually no international sanctions on IRI. But then suddenly all started.

march 2006 - Resolution 1696 - demanding to end uranium enrichment.

december 2006 - Resolution 1737 - bans import and export of sensitive nuclear material and equipment, freezes the financial assets of those involved in Iran's nuclear activities.

march 2007 - Resolution 1803 - bans all of Iran's arms exports. freezes the assets and restricted the travel of people it deemed involved in the nuclear program. Encouraged scrutiny of the dealings of Iranian banks, allowed inspections of Iranian cargo ships and planes.

june 2010 - Resolution 1929 - Prohibits Iran from buying heavy weapons such as attack helicopters and missiles. Toughen rules on financial transactions with Iranian banks and increase the number of Iranian individuals and companies that are targeted with asset freezes and travel bans.

Finally in 2012 started really tough sanctions on Iranian economy: ban of oil export to EU, disconnection from SWIFT.

So everything started after Ahmadinejad's election. Coincidence?
